| Parking/Access Road Notes: |
Very limited room to park (maybe two vehicles), along with a two page notice from the Rumney Police Department about parking restrictions. Large boulders added to the side of the road to prevent roadside parking. |
|
| Surface Conditions: |
Dry Trail, Mud - Minor/Avoidable |
|
| Recommended Equipment: |
|
|
| Water Crossing Notes: |
Dry |
|
| Trail Maintenance Notes: |
Large stepover blowdown about 1/10 mile up (may be able to break and move with a rock bar). Smaller stepover near the top of the steeps. |
